The first key to success in fantasy cricket is Squad Selection in Fantasy Cricket. Each fantasy cricket platform usually has a budget limit (for example, Fantasy Akhada might give you a budget of 100), which means you have to choose your players within that budget. Prioritize selecting players who are in good form, consistently play, and have a strong performance history in the specific format of the game.

Selecting the right team composition is key to Squad Selection in Fantasy Cricket success. It’s important to balance your team with a mix of batsmen, bowlers, and all-rounders. Understanding how to balance your fantasy cricket team: bowlers and batsmen will give you an edge over your competitors and help you score more fantasy points. Generally, batsmen score more points than bowlers, but a solid bowling lineup can also be very valuable.

All-rounders are crucial as they contribute with both bat and ball, earning extra points. A successful fantasy cricket team should include a combination of top-order and middle-order batsmen, along with dependable all-rounders and bowlers. This mix ensures your team can handle any changes and maintain a strong performance across all areas.

Consider the playing conditions when selecting your squad. Different players excel under different conditions. For instance, spinners might perform better on spin-friendly pitches in India compared to fast bowlers.

Weather and pitch conditions are also crucial. Bad weather, like heavy rain, can affect bowlers’ ability to take wickets, while a damp pitch might slow down batsmen. Always check the weather forecast and analyze players’ performance in similar conditions before finalizing your team. Pitches can favor either spin or pace, and knowing the pitch type can help you make better choices. Review pitch reports and recent player performances on similar pitches to guide your selection.

Lastly, evaluate the strengths and weaknesses of the opposing team. Look at their recent performances, their batting and bowling lineup, and their style of play. For example, if the opponent has a strong batting lineup, choose bowlers who are likely to take wickets. Conversely, if the opponent’s bowling is weak, pick batsmen who are likely to score well.

Managing Injuries in Fantasy Cricket

Injuries are a frequent issue in cricket and can greatly affect a player’s performance and, consequently, your fantasy team’s score. It’s important to monitor injury updates for players, especially those expected to score heavily or take many wickets.

If a player is injured, replace them with someone likely to perform well in their place. Keep an eye on the team’s bench strength and review the recent performances of potential replacements.

In addition to injuries, player form and recent performances should influence your squad selection. If a player has been out of form, it might be best to exclude them from your squad. Conversely, if a player has been performing exceptionally well, they could be a valuable addition, even if they’re not a major star.

Consider the match schedule as well. If there are several matches in a short period, choose players who are likely to play in all of them. On the other hand, if there are breaks between matches, pick players who are expected to excel in the specific match you’re focusing on.
